Play Overview
XCOM (1994) is a science fiction strategic battle game where you control units to stop an alien invasion. The long-running series has come in many forms, but always has in common the finely tuned turn-based ground combat where you control a squad of soldiers to hunt the aliens.
Tactics are important, as you can’t see enemies until you have line of sight. You also need to carefully equip and use soldiers abilities to perform different duties. You can take cover behind walls and objects in the environment as well as save your movement for opportunity fire. Then between missions you can train, research and equip for the next challenge.

- XCOM: Enemy Unknown (2012) on Android, iOS, PC, Mac, PlayStation 3, PlayStation Vita, Xbox 360
- The Bureau: XCOM Declassified (2013) on Mac, PC, PlayStation 3, Xbox 360
- XCOM: Enemy Within (2013) an expansion for XCOM: Enemy Unknown on Android, iOS, PC, Mac, PlayStation 3, PlayStation Vita, Xbox 360
- XCOM 2 (2016) on Mac, PC, PlayStation 4, Xbox One
- XCOM 2: War of the Chosen (2017) an expansion for XCOM 2 on Mac, PC, PlayStation 4, and Xbox One
- XCOM: Chimera Squad (2020) a budget standalone game on PC.
The combination of turn-based strategy and squad tactics spawned a genre of its own with many spin-off games from the XCOM mould. These are worth noting if you are looking for this kind of experience on other systems:
- Rebelstar Tactical Commander on GBA
- Ghost Recon Shadow Wars on the 3DS
- Mario vs Rabbids on Switch

Age Ratings
Rated for younger players in the US. XCOM 2 rated ESRB TEEN for Blood, Use of Tobacco, and Violence. From a top-down perspective, players manage resources, engage in combat missions, rescue characters, and terrorize alien installations. Players use rifles, machine guns, pistols, and grenades to kill enemies (e.g., human-, insect-, beast-like characters) in turn-based combat. Attack moves occur in brief cutscenes that depict characters getting shot or wounded/killed by explosions. Splashes and pools of yellow and red blood sometimes appear when characters are injured or killed. During the course of the game, players can customize soldiers with accessories, including lit cigarettes and cigars.
